Smart Wearables: Beyond Fitness Tracking
As technology continues to advance at an unprecedented pace, smart wearables are evolving into multifaceted accessories that offer much more than basic fitness tracking. By 2025, we can expect these devices to encompass a vast array of innovative features that significantly enhance user experience and encourage proactive health management.
Health monitoring is set to reach new heights, with smart wearables incorporating advanced sensors capable of tracking a wide range of vital signs. Future devices may monitor blood glucose levels, blood pressure, and even respiratory rates in real time, providing users with invaluable data to make informed health decisions. This integration of health technology aims not only to assist those with chronic conditions but also to support preventative health measures for all users.

Augmented reality (AR) capabilities are also poised to become a key feature among smart wearables. Imagine a smartwatch that allows users to access virtual interfaces, receive navigation prompts, and interact with other digital elements seamlessly. Such enhancements will become commonplace, allowing users to experience their devices in a more immersive manner. This level of interaction may transform the way we engage with our environment and manage our daily tasks.
The market for smart rings and health-focused accessories is expanding, catering to both technology enthusiasts and everyday users looking for convenience without compromising on style. Smart rings, for instance, are compact yet powerful, integrating functionalities such as sleep monitoring, activity tracking, and contactless payment options into a sleek design. These wearable devices appeal to those who desire discreet yet effective health monitoring solutions.
In summary, the landscape of smart wearables is dramatically shifting as we approach 2025. With advancements in health monitoring, augmented reality, and a diverse array of devices, smart wearables are becoming essential companions for various lifestyles, aiding users in navigating their health and day-to-day activities more effectively.
Eco-Friendly Charging Solutions
As consumers become increasingly aware of environmental issues, the demand for eco-friendly charging solutions has surged. These innovative accessories are designed to reduce carbon footprints while maintaining efficiency, thereby revolutionizing how we power our devices. One notable trend is the rising popularity of solar-powered chargers. These chargers harness the sun’s energy, providing a sustainable power source for smartphones, tablets, and laptops. With advancements in solar technology, modern versions are more efficient than ever, offering high-energy conversion rates that make them a practical choice for consumers seeking green alternatives.
In addition to solar chargers, biodegradable cables have entered the market as another eco-conscious accessory. These cables are made from materials that decompose over time, significantly reducing electronic waste. Unlike traditional plastic cables that can take hundreds of years to break down, biodegradable options offer a sustainable solution without compromising performance. The rise in awareness regarding plastic pollution has fueled consumer interest in these alternatives, prompting many manufacturers to shift towards greener production methods.
Moreover, energy-efficient wireless charging pads have redefined convenience while promoting sustainability. These pads utilize induction technology to minimize energy loss during charging, ensuring that a greater percentage of energy is transferred to the device. Brands leading this eco-innovation movement include well-known companies committed to sustainability, such as Anker and Belkin, which have introduced a range of eco-friendly products. These brands prioritize both performance and environmental responsibility, ensuring that their products not only meet consumer needs but also contribute positively to the planet.
Eco-friendly charging solutions are more than just a trend; they signify a shift towards responsible consumerism. By investing in such accessories, individuals can play a part in promoting sustainability, demonstrating that efficiency and environmental considerations can coexist seamlessly in today’s tech-savvy world.
Enhanced Audio Accessories for Every Experience
The evolution of audio accessories has played a pivotal role in enhancing user experiences across various environments. As we progress into 2025, significant improvements in sound quality, connectivity, and design will define the audio accessory market. Wireless earbuds, for instance, have moved beyond basic functionalities, with manufacturers now prioritizing high-fidelity sound, longer battery life, and advanced noise-canceling technology. This trend reflects growing consumer demand for superior audio experiences during activities such as workouts, commutes, and leisure time.
Noise-canceling technology has become an indispensable feature for many users, providing an escape from external distractions. In 2025, we anticipate further innovations in this realm, with adaptive noise cancellation becoming more prevalent. This technology allows users to customize their audio environment dynamically, responding to the surrounding noise levels while maintaining an immersive sound experience. Furthermore, the integration of artificial intelligence within earbuds will enable personalized sound profiles, catering to individual listening preferences based on user behavior and context.

Portable speakers have also seen remarkable advancements, becoming essential companions for outdoor gatherings, travel, and home entertainment. The focus on durability, waterproofing, and portability will dominate the design considerations for these speakers. Users will increasingly gravitate towards devices that offer robust sound quality without compromising on portability. Additionally, seamless connectivity through advanced Bluetooth and multi-device pairing capabilities will cater to the needs of tech-savvy consumers seeking versatility.
Another trend influencing audio accessory offerings is the demand for eco-friendly materials, aligning with a broader emphasis on sustainability. As awareness of environmental issues grows, consumers are likely to prefer brands that utilize recycled materials and promote sustainable manufacturing practices. Overall, the landscape of audio accessories in 2025 will be characterized by technological advancements, user-centric designs, and the seamless integration of audio experiences across various lifestyles.
4. Smart Home Integration: The Rise of Multi-functional Accessories
The evolution of smart home technology has accelerated the development of multi-functional device accessories that significantly enhance user experience. With items such as smart plugs, security cameras, and home assistants becoming increasingly prevalent, these accessories are revolutionizing how individuals interact with their living environments. By streamlining connectivity and offering automation features, these accessories allow for improved compatibility across various ecosystems, creating a cohesive smart home experience.
Smart plugs, for instance, enable users to control electronic devices remotely, facilitating energy management and promoting sustainability. Users can schedule when devices turn on or off, reducing energy waste and enhancing convenience. Similarly, modern security cameras, equipped with advanced features such as motion detection, night vision, and cloud storage, provide homeowners with peace of mind by offering real-time monitoring and alerts. These devices can often be integrated seamlessly into existing smart home systems, allowing for centralized control from smartphones or virtual assistants.
Home assistants like Google Home and Amazon Echo have become pivotal to this trend, acting as hubs that connect various smart devices. They enhance user convenience by enabling voice commands, creating routines, and facilitating automation of everyday tasks. The compatibility of these devices with diverse platforms ensures flexibility for users to tailor their smart home environments to their unique preferences. As the demand for interconnected devices continues to grow, manufacturers are innovating new solutions that prioritize ease of use and enhanced functionality, aligning with the lifestyle of modern consumers.
Thus, with the rise of multi-functional accessories, the concept of a smart home becomes a daily reality rather than a futuristic dream. These accessories are not simply add-ons but essential components in transforming everyday living, enabling users to enjoy increased efficiency and a higher standard of comfort in their homes.
